New Revenue Streams

New Revenue Streams

CMS remote patient monitoring reimbursement codes (CPT 99453, 99454, 99457, 99458) create sustainable revenue opportunities. Our platforms include automated time tracking, compliant documentation, and billing integration that ensure you capture appropriate reimbursement for monitoring services while meeting all program requirements.

Process We Follow to Deliver Remote Patient Monitoring Development Services

Our remote patient monitoring development process combines connected health expertise with rigorous clinical validation to deliver solutions that achieve adoption targets and measurable improvements in outcomes.

01

Clinical Discovery & Use Case Definition

We begin by understanding your clinical objectives, target patient populations, and care delivery model. This phase identifies monitored conditions, required vital signs, alert protocols, care team workflows, and integration requirements. We document clinical endpoints that define program success.

02

Device Strategy & Selection

Our team evaluates medical devices and wearables against your clinical requirements, considering accuracy, patient usability, connectivity reliability, and cost. We recommend devices that balance clinical validity with patient acceptance, ensuring high monitoring adherence rates.

03

Platform Architecture & Design

We architect scalable, secure platforms that handle your projected patient volumes with room for growth. UX design focuses on both patient apps optimized for diverse populations and care team dashboards engineered for clinical efficiency. Wireframes and prototypes are validated with clinical stakeholders before development.

04

Agile Development & Device Integration

Using sprint-based development, we build platform features while simultaneously integrating selected medical devices. Device integration includes Bluetooth pairing workflows, data parsing, unit conversion, and quality validation. Continuous testing ensures reliable data capture across device manufacturers.

05

Clinical Validation & Testing

Beyond functional testing, we validate that the platform supports intended clinical workflows and produces reliable data for clinical decision-making. Alert logic is tested against clinical scenarios, and integration accuracy is verified against EHR documentation. Security and compliance assessments confirm regulatory readiness.

06

Deployment & Continuous Optimization

Platform deployment includes device provisioning, patient enrollment, care team training, and phased rollouts with initial cohort feedback. Post-launch support features 24/7 monitoring, firmware updates, and clinical workflow refinements. We track enrollment rates, adherence, alert volumes, and outcomes to recommend optimizations that improve program effectiveness.

FAQs on Remote Patient Monitoring Development Services

Remote patient monitoring (RPM) is a healthcare delivery method that uses connected medical devices to collect patient health data outside traditional clinical settings. Patients use devices like blood pressure monitors, pulse oximeters, glucose meters, and wearables at home. Data is automatically transmitted to a cloud platform, where clinical teams monitor readings, receive alerts for concerning values, and intervene proactively. RPM enables continuous care management rather than episodic office visits.
